WebFeb 4, 2011 · The French Connection. The concept of entrepreneur is borrowed from the French words entreprendre, “one who undertakes”—that is, a “manager.”. In fact, the word entrepreneur was shaped probably from celui qui entreprend, which is loosely translated as “those who get things done.”. In the early eighteenth century, a group of ...

WebEntrepreneur means a person who sets up a business or businesses, taking on financial risks in the hope of profit. The word “Entrepreneur” comes from the Middle French verb “Entreprendre” which means “to begin something; undertake”. In Middle French, the addition of “eur” at the end of a verb is used to make agent words.
